All Departments have departmental Library <strong>with</strong> open access.GYMKHANAThe activities of the Gymkhana are managed by the Gymkhana Managing Committee under the solecharge of a senior member of the staff as its Chairperson responsible for co-ordinating the activities invarious fields of sports, both-indoor and outdoor. Each game/department is directly controlled by astaff member as a Sports Director, and a student secretary.Since the College does not have its own play-ground, arrangements are made to hiregrounds/playing fields in different localities for each sport game.Expert coaches are appointed whenever necessary to train students in different games.College celebrates Annual Sports Day. Provision exists to admit outstanding sportsmen/women andincentives are provided to such players by way of sports scholarship /free ship. College colours areawarded for outstanding performances on the field.National Cadet Corps (N.C.C)The College enrolls students for the Senior Division N.C.C. under the 6 th Maharashtra Bn N.C.C. Thecadets get opportunity to attend various camps such as A.T.C., N.I.C., Army Attachment andParasailing to name a few. Cadets are also encouraged to try to get selected for the Republic DayParade. Various camps/exhibitions are also conducted <strong>with</strong>in the College.National Service Scheme (N.S.S)Students are encouraged to participate in Social Services through its NSS unit, which is very activeand involves the students in various projects related to Community based development, Environmentissues, Child Welfare, Poverty eradication programmes, Cleanliness drive etc in rural area. It alsoconducts an Annual Camp during the winter vacation.ASSOCIATIONS1. The College runs several Associations which are social, linguistic and cultural innature. TheEnglish Literacy Association, Marathi Wangmaya Mandal, Kannada Sangha, Hindi SahityaParishad, Commerce Association, Economics Association, Philosophy Association, HistoryAssociation, Geo Club, Political Science Association, Sociology Association, Space Point Club,Nature Club, Finance &Accountancy Association, Talent Search Club.
